Fried Polenta Sticks

Cultural Context

Originating from Northern Italy, polenta is a traditional dish made from cornmeal, often enjoyed by peasants for its versatility and heartiness. Fried polenta sticks are a delightful way to enjoy this staple, providing a crispy texture that contrasts with the creamy interior. Today, polenta has gained popularity worldwide, appearing in various forms and preparations, from gourmet appetizers to comforting side dishes.

1

Bring water to a boil in a large pot.

2

Add salt to the boiling water.

3

Gradually whisk in corn flour, stirring constantly.

4

Cook until thickened, about 5-7 minutes.

5

Stir in grated parmesan cheese and black pepper.

6

Spread the polenta mixture onto a baking sheet.

7

Let it cool completely, about 30 minutes.

8

Cut the cooled polenta into sticks or fries.

9

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at until shimmering.

10

Fry the polenta sticks until golden brown, about 3-4 minutes per side.

11

Remove and drain on paper towels.

12

Serve warm with fresh herbs.
